I always tell kids when they are 14 or 15 to go to a funeral of someone that they don't know that well. That way, they are a little more prepared for dealing with the emotions when it is someone that they care for.

A good funeral director is a professional who helps you identify and cope with the emotions. After a few, funerals aren't as difficult because you've thought through things before you arrive.

You never really avoid emotions, you can only suppress them. Some people face them in a series of smaller moments, but you can't ever avoid them.
